Transaction 268efe349a7c96e66993f8a5c8ad627f79791fb500659e80519b79012236a0ae
1 Input
1 Output
-
268efe349a7c96e66993f8a5c8ad627f79791fb500659e80519b79012236a0ae:0
- value
- 73493
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c53f2445152268c17bbafbd387e532a015eb400 OP_EQUAL
- address
- 3QhCmabRa1YHpM4SNteR3RSFb24fcqDQy9